Book excerpt: One of the biggest problems facing someone getting into the dairy or meat goat business is recognizing that it is not a quick easy business to get into and operate. Too many people see goats as nice, easy to manage animals that take little in the way of facilities, land, or labor. While some of this may be true in comparison to a bovine dairy, much is just blue sky speculation based on wants, not realities. We must determine what our dreams and desires are in the context of the sober realities of the real business world. A lack of knowledge and planning has caused the short-term run of more than one goat operation, in particular new dairy goat start- ups. Anyone interested in goats needs to spend some time with several people in the business. You need to be knowledgeable about the business needs, husbandry needs, markets, and do a careful assessment of financial needs. Key Questions What are your goals? - Is this a supplemental income or intended as a family support activity? - Do you plan on all family labor to be concentrated in the business or will you expect outside income for the short term or long term? - How much money do you need for family living? - Can you really make money doing this? Book excerpt: The goat dairy industry in Wisconsin is a niche market. Currently, there are 165 licensed goat dairies in the state. According to manufacturers of goat milk products, sales are increasing by 10 to 15 percent annually. Despite the rapid growth of the industry, operating a profitable goat dairy requires careful planning and management. The main purpose of this "Best Practices Guide" is to provide some insight into the dairy goat industry. This guide contains basic knowledge to help those who are considering a dairy goat operation make a sound decision as to whether or not this would be a viable business for them.Success in the industry is not guaranteed. A goat dairy farmer in this "Best Practices Guide" is defined as a farm milking at least 50 does and selling their milk to a milk plant. There are a few exceptions but most plants require a farm to be milking at least 50 does before they will consider picking up their milk due to the cost of transportation. A farmstead dairy is one in which the farm processes their own milk and sells their own product. Before deciding to start a commercial dairy goat operation, it is critical to ask yourself several questions:The first question that you will need to answer is: "Why do I want to become a dairy goat farmer?" If the answer is "I love dairy goats and it would be a cool way to make a living," make sure you're not getting ahead of yourself. You may want to start with just a few goats, milking them for your own use, and looking at other possibilities for working with goats. If the answer is "I like goats and I feel that I have the ability to manage a dairy herd and make a reasonable income," then you may want to do your homework and decide if a goat dairy is for you. This needs to be viewed as a business venture.

Book excerpt: Goat science covers quite a wide range and varieties of topics, from genetics and breeding, via nutrition, production systems, reproduction, milk and meat production, animal health and parasitism, etc., up to the effects of goat products on human health. In this book, several parts of them are presented within 18 different chapters. Molecular genetics and genetic improvement of goats are the new approaches of goat development. Several factors affect the passage rate of digesta in goats, but for diet properties, goats are similar to other ruminants. Iodine deficiency in goats could be dangerous. Assisted reproduction techniques have similar importance in goats like in other ruminants. Milk and meat production traits of goats are almost equally important and have significant positive impacts on human health. Many factors affect the health of goats, heat stress being of increasing importance. Production systems could modify all of the abovementioned characteristics of goats.
